520 _a"[This book] provides a visual guide to many of the specific properties, activities and procedures associated with microorganisms and helminths (worms). It also discusses selected features of a number of infectious diseases. In short, this book is intended to present microorganisms to anyone who is interested and curious about the microbial world. Individuals, whether familiar or not familiar with this microscopic world of life, can gain some perspective as to the many types of microorganisms and their activities that exist in the world around them."--Preface, p. xvii. This extremely readable, well-illustrated, presentation covers a wide range of microorganisms and their activities. It presents photographs and data about organisms that are not normally found in laboratory manuals and often not found in textbooks. Readers learn the characteristics of various types of microorganisms, along with pertinent information about microorganism-caused disease (bacterial, fungal, protozoan, viral, helminthic). Updates and increases coverage of basic laboratory procedures and associated results, the domains of microbal life, immunology, and infectious diseases. Increased emphasis on the features of viruses and prions: discusses the use of selected agents of bioterrorism, and adds coverage on the SARS agent, Ebola and Marburg viruses, and the human metapneumovirus. Features new illustrations throughout that emphasize the variety of microorganisms and their activities, increasing the microbiology perspective. A laboratory supplement for students studying to be nurses, medical assistants, dental assistants, medical technologists. It may also be used in biology majors labs.
